The wrinkle is postage
Shipping is free on the three and six-bottle packages. The two-bottle package adds $9.99.
That sounds trivial and it is not, because it lands on the smallest order. Two bottles is $158 plus $9.99, which is $167.99 for 60 servings — about $2.80 a day, not the $2.63 the sticker price implies.
The three, with postage folded in
Two bottles: $167.99 all in, 60 servings, roughly $2.80 a day.
Three bottles: $207, 90 servings, roughly $2.30 a day.
Six bottles: $294, 180 servings, roughly $1.63 a day.
Note what that does to the middle option. Three bottles costs $39 more than two, and for that you get thirty extra days of capsules, free postage and a lower daily cost. It is the step with the best value change in it.
Now bring the guarantee back in
Sixty days from purchase. Two bottles is exactly sixty servings, so the product and the window end together — tidy, but it means no margin at all if you start late.
Three bottles is ninety days and six is a hundred and eighty. Both outlast the guarantee, which is not a trap so long as you decide inside the first two months rather than at the last bottle.
